Deep Learning: An Increasingly Common HPC Task

Deep learning is a highly compute- and data-intensive category of tasks with wide applicability in science as well as industry. Join Paola Buitrago and Joel Welling from the Pittsburgh Supercomputing Center in two talks that will provide an overview of the current deep learning landscape and examples of the deep learning environments available to XSEDE users. Paola will provide a brief history of the field and an update on its technical performance, with examples from domains as diverse as vision and theorem proving. Joel will follow with a description of the PSC's support for two major deep learning packages, TensorFlow and Caffe.
